Clinton County and Scott County have issued burn bans. ... but there are a few features you should look for to ensure you’re getting ...The smoke is a known health and environmental hazard. EPA emission tests show one burn barrel emits up to 80 times more pollution and up to 11 times the dioxin per pound of garbage burned than a municipal waste incinerator that serves tens of thousands of homes. Burn ban issued for Cedar, Clinton, Jackson, Muscatine, Scott CountiesTherefore pursuant to Iowa Code 100.40(1), a Burn Ban is in effect as of 04/12/2023 at 08:00 am for all of Scott County, Iowa. Current conditions & concerns:Mar 6, 2024 · Scott County, Iowa, has been reduced enough to remove the Countywide Burn Ban. In pursuant to Iowa Code 100.40(1) (1995), Scott County’s Burn Ban has been lifted effective 03/06/2024 at 11:00 am for all of Scott County, Iowa. Please continue to use caution and follow all recommended safety procedures when conducting a controlled burn.
